Types of Exercise Bikes

When considering an exercise bike, it's crucial to comprehend the different types offered in the market. Each type deals with specific requirements and preferences. Below is a relative table showcasing the main kinds of stationary bicycle:

Type of Exercise BikeDescriptionProsCons
Upright BikeResembles a standard bike with a vertical seating position.- Compact design
- Engages core and upper body
- May cause pain to the lower back
- Less encouraging for novices
Recumbent BikeFunctions a bigger seat with back support, permitting a reclining position.- Comfortable for long exercises
- Better for individuals with lower back problems
- Larger footprint
- Less core engagement
Spin BikeDeveloped for high-intensity cycling, imitating roadway biking.- Excellent for intense workouts
- Adjustable resistance levels
- read more Can be uncomfortable without appropriate change
- Not appropriate for casual riders
Air BikeMakes use of air resistance, providing a full-body exercise with moving handlebars.- Adjustable resistance based on effort
- Great for HIIT training
- Noise level might be higher
- Can be overwhelming for newbies

Benefits of Using an Exercise Bike

Engaging with a stationary bicycle uses a plethora of benefits, making it an exceptional choice for people aiming to enhance their fitness levels. Here are some essential advantages:

  1. Cardiovascular Health: Regular biking enhances heart health, improves blood circulation, and enhances lung capability.

  2. Low Impact: Exercise bikes provide a low-impact exercise option, decreasing stress on joints and decreasing the danger of injury, making them ideal for all age groups and physical fitness levels.

  3. Weight-loss: Cycling assists burn calories successfully, contributing to weight-loss and weight management goals.

  4. Convenience: Having a stationary bicycle at home enables individuals to work out at their benefit, overcoming barriers associated with weather conditions or fitness center hours.

  5. Personalized Workouts: Exercise bikes frequently feature adjustable settings, allowing users to customize their exercises from mild rides to high-intensity sessions.
